Putin boasts about new nuclear-powered missile as he digs in over Russia’s demands on Ukraine

Summary

Russian President Vladimir Putin announced the successful test of a new nuclear-powered missile called Burevestnik. This missile, capable of avoiding missile defenses, sends a signal to President Donald Trump amid calls for a ceasefire in Ukraine. Putin's move underscores his demands regarding Ukraine and its possible NATO membership.

Key Facts

  • Russia tested a nuclear-powered missile named Burevestnik, which means “storm petrel.”
  • The missile is designed to have unlimited range and can evade defenses.
  • Putin first revealed this missile in 2018 along with other new weapons.
  • The recent test flight covered 14,000 kilometers in 15 hours.
  • The Burevestnik is intended to ensure Russia can retaliate against a first strike, even with U.S. missile defenses.
  • Western experts worry about the radiation risks associated with the missile.
  • Development continued despite previous test failures.
